Befriending, and other things

Kent Association for the Blind

Our main roles are befriending and an active persons walk but we do have occasional driving roles, roadshows, and one off events such as our sensory walk in July.

A caring nature and the ability to listen. Willingness to drive can be helpful but not essential. Would need own vehicle

The knowledge that you have brightened the day of a visually impaired person. It is priceless.
